A device with 8 inputs can't necessarily record on 8 channels at the same time. You need to dig deep when researching each device.
Be wary of spiel in product listings.
Edit: it's got less to do with transfer speeds and more to do with cost. Inputs = cheap, outputs = expensive. So some manufacturers mislead you into thinking you can record 8 tracks, when everything is actually mixed down to 2. -
